Police raid home in Ocean County Drug Bust

by Charlie Dwyer

Beachwood, NJ – The Detective Bureau of the Beachwood Police Department has concluded an investigation into the distribution of narcotics at a residence located at 84 Birch Street. Through the detectives’ efforts, the investigation successfully identified individuals involved in the distribution of narcotics from the residence, as well as a “Wildwood” camper situated on the property.

On May 1st, a court-authorized search warrant was executed at 84 Birch Street by members of the Beachwood Police Department in collaboration with the Ocean County Regional SWAT team.

The joint operation aimed to curb illegal drug activities in the area. As a result of the search, law enforcement officials located drugs in the possession of two individuals at the home.

Timothy Claus, 53, was found to be in possession of Methamphetamine, while Florio Rasoilo, 54, was found to be in possession of Oxycodone pills.

Claus has been charged with Possession of Methamphetamine, Possession of Drug Paraphernalia, and Possession/Distribution within 500 feet of a public park. He was taken to the Ocean County Jail, where he will remain pending a detention hearing.

Rasoilo faces charges of possession without a lawful prescription and Possession of Drug Paraphernalia. Rasoilo was served with a summons complaint and released.

The ‘Wildwood’ camper located on the premises was seized, pending forfeiture, as part of the ongoing investigation.
